EliteX Unveils Transformational Female Coaches to Follow, 2026 Edition

March 2026/EliteXPress/ – EliteX Unveils “Transformational Female Coaches to Follow, 2026” Edition — Celebrating Women Driving Growth, Leadership, and Lasting Impact

EliteX, a global business media and recognition platform, proudly announces the release of its latest editorial showcase, “Transformational Female Coaches to Follow, 2026.” This special edition highlights a powerful group of women whose work in coaching, leadership development, and personal transformation is reshaping how individuals and organisations grow, adapt, and succeed.

In a world where change is constant and leadership demands continue to evolve, these coaches stand out for their ability to guide individuals through complexity with clarity, purpose, and confidence. Their work spans executive leadership, mindset transformation, organisational change, and human potential development.

Featured Transformational Female Coaches to Follow, 2026:

  • Teresa Sacco – Cover leader and Master Certified Coach recognised for her integrated approach to leadership, combining strategy, emotional intelligence, and systemic transformation.
  • Anu Sachar – Leadership coach known for empowering individuals and organisations to unlock clarity, confidence, and purpose-driven growth.
  • Edith Hamilton – Executive coach whose work focuses on leadership development, behavioural transformation, and meaningful organisational impact.
  • Ellen Kocher – Accomplished coach recognised for her commitment to helping individuals navigate change and achieve sustainable growth through coaching excellence.
  • Sonia McDonald – Global leadership coach dedicated to helping leaders build authenticity, courage, and human-centred leadership practices.
  • Sophia Casey – Master Certified Coach and global leadership expert known for empowering executives and teams to lead with clarity, confidence, and purpose.
